Suppose you take out a 20-year mortgage for a house that costs $397744. Assume the following:
The annual interest rate on the mortgage is 5%.
The bank requires a minimum down payment of 17% at the time of the loan.
The annual property tax is 2.4% of the cost of the house.
The annual homeowner's insurance is 1.3% of the cost of the house.
The monthly PMI is $68
Your other long-term debts require payments of $558 per month.
If you make the minimum down payment, what is the minimum gross monthly salary you must earn in order to satisfy the 28% rule and the 36% rule simultaneously?
Explanation / Answer
TOTAL LOAN AMOUNT FOR HOUSE AFTER PAYING DOWN PAYMENT= 397744 X 83% = 330,128 (AS MINIMUM DOWN PAYMENT 17%)
FOR REPAYMENT OF THIS LOAN MONTHLY INSTALLMENT (EMI) IS CALCULATED AS
LOAN = A[(1+i)n-1] / i(1+i)n => 330128 = A[ (1 + 5/1200)12x20 -1] / 5/1200(1+5/1200)12x20 (AS R = 5%ANNUAL, N= 12X20)
=> 330128 = A [ (1.0041667)240- 1] / (0.00416670 )(1.0041667)240
=> 330128 = A (2.71264-1) / (0.0041667)( 2.71264)
=> 330128 X 0.004667 X 2.71264 = A (1.71264)
=> 3731.36 /1.71264 =A => A = 2178.72
NOW PROPERTY TAX = 397744 X 2.4% =9545.86 PER YEAR = 795.48/MONTH
HOME OWNER`S INSURANCE = 397744 X 1.3% = 5170.67 PER YEAR = 430.89 PER MONTH
PMI = 68 PER MONTH
HENCE TOTAL MONTHLY COST FOR HOUSE = 2178.72 + 795.48+ 430.89 + 68 = 3473.09
NOW FRONT END RATIO = (TOTAL COST FOR HOUSE PER MONTH) / SALARY PER MONTH MUST BE LESS THAN 28%
HENCE 3473.09 / SALARY < 2 8% => SALARY >(3473.09 X 100) /28 = 12,403.89
AGAIN FOR BANK END RATIO = (TOTAL COST PER MONTH FOR HOUSE + OHTER LOAN INSTALLMENT)/ SALARY < 36%
=> (3473.09+558) / SALARY < 36% => 4031.09/SALARY < 36/100
SALARY > (4031.09 X 100)/36 = 11197.47
HENCE FOR SATISFYING BOTH RULE SIMULTANEOUSLY SALARY MUST BE MORE THAN $ 12403.90
